Using the traditional champagne method, vintage Sekt is matured for at least 24 months on yeast lees. This gives rise to delicate biscuit notes on the nose. Delicately aromatic fruit reminiscent of apricot and refined nutty aromas, lively acid structures on the palate with subtle yeasty notes. A very fine and lively sparkling wine.

Just like music, wine is an essential part of Viennese culture. In 1817, Ludwig van Beethoven resided in the historic house of Mayer am Pfarrplatz. During his stay in Vienna, he worked on the famous Symphony N° 9.
To honour the great composer, the winery Mayer am Pfarrplatz created a special wine – just as lively and spicy as the famous symphony and a real pleasure to drink.
